[and] will promote particularly unitary or ‘one-eyed’ forms of consciousness.” The very first problem any student of South African literature is confronted with, will be the range on the literary systems. Gerrit Olivier notes, "Even though it truly is common to listen to teachers and politicians mention a 'South African literature', the specific situation at ground degree is characterised by diversity and even fragmentation". Robert Mossman provides that "Among the enduring and saddest legacies with the apartheid system may very well be that nobody – White, Black, Coloured (meaning of combined-race in South Africa), or Asian – can at any time discuss to be a "South African." The problem, on the other hand, pre-dates Apartheid considerably, as South Africa is a rustic designed up of communities which have generally been linguistically and culturally varied. These cultures have all retained autonomy to some extent, building a compilation like the controversial Southern African Literatures by Michael Chapman, tricky. Chapman raises the problem: [W]hose language, culture, or story could be reported to possess authority in South Africa if the finish of apartheid has lifted tough questions as to what it can be being a South African, what it is to are now living in a different South Africa, whether South Africa can be a country, and, if so, what its mythos is, what needs being overlooked and what remembered as we scour the earlier so as to be aware of the existing and request a path ahead into an not known long term. South Africa has eleven countrywide languages: Afrikaans, English, Zulu, Xhosa, Sotho, Pedi, Tswana, Venda, SiSwati, Tsonga, and Ndebele. Any definitive literary historical past of South Africa really should, it could be argued, examine literature manufactured in all eleven languages. But the only literature ever to undertake qualities that may be explained to be "countrywide" is Afrikaans.

Olivier argues: "Of all of the literatures in South Africa, Afrikaans literature has become the only just one to are becoming a countrywide literature while in the perception that it formulated a transparent image of by itself like a individual entity, Which by way of institutional entrenchment through instructing, distribution, a review culture, journals, etcetera. it could make sure the continuation of that concept." Element of the trouble is usually that English literature has long been seen within the bigger context of English writing on the planet, and it has, thanks to English's global position as lingua franca, not been viewed as autonomous or indigenous to South Africa – in Olivier’s words: "English literature in South Africa continues to become a kind of extension of British or Worldwide English literature." The African languages, However, are spoken through the borders of Southern Africa - one example is, Tswana is spoken in Botswana, and Tsonga in Zimbabwe, and Sotho in Lesotho. South Africa's borders ended up drawn up via the British Empire and, just like all other colonies, these borders ended up drawn with out regard for the men and women living inside them. Thus: inside a background of South African literature, will we incorporate all Tswana writers, or only those with South African citizenship? Chapman bypasses this issue by which include "Southern" African literatures. The next challenge with the African languages is accessibility, mainly because Considering that the African languages are regional languages, none of them can assert the readership on the nationwide scale corresponding to Afrikaans and English. Sotho, For illustration, while transgressing the national borders of your RSA, is on the other hand largely spoken within the Free Condition, and bears an incredible volume of relation for the language of Natal one example is, Zulu. Therefore the language are not able to claim a national readership, although Conversely being "Intercontinental" inside the feeling that it transgresses the countrywide borders.
